Emerging Advancements Reshaping the Industrial Sector
The present manufacturing industry is undergoing a profound transformation fueled by innovative technologies. Robotics is no longer a potential concept but a practice across various factories. We're seeing increased adoption of additive manufacturing, permitting for greater flexibility and lower lead times. The Industrial of Devices (IoT) is providing live data insights, enhancing operations and decreasing waste. Machine intelligence (AI) and statistical algorithms are powering proactive maintenance, boosting quality control, and streamlining production networks. These developments deliver a different era of efficiency and competitiveness for companies globally.

Manufacturer Case Study: Overcoming Output Hurdles
A recent case study reveals how a major company of niche industrial equipment, "Precision Dynamics," faced significant manufacturing bottlenecks. Initially, the company was struggling with prolonged lead times, rising costs, and reduced buyer satisfaction. The main issues stemmed from unreliable provider deliveries, inefficient process management, and a lack of real-time information. To fix these challenges, Precision Dynamics adopted a three-pronged approach. To begin with, they broadened their vendor base, building relationships with multiple sources to mitigate supply chain dangers. Furthermore, the company improved their workflow by employing lean manufacturing principles and simplifying repetitive duties. Lastly, they deployed a modern insight reporting tool to gain real-time visibility into output performance. The outcomes were remarkable, including a lowering in lead times by 40%, a reduction in manufacturing costs of 15%, and a noticeable enhancement in client satisfaction.
